What is the shape of SeO3?

According to VSEPR theory and hybridization of the molecule, the geometry and shape are trigonal planar. Hence the SeO3 lewis structure is trigonal planar in shape with a bond angle of 120 degrees.

What is the hybridization of SeO3?

The expected hybridization of selenium in SeO3 S e O 3 is sp2 s p 2 .

How many lone pairs does SeO3 have?

Lewis structure of SeO3 contains three double bonds between the Selenium (Se) atom and each Oxygen (O) atom. The Selenium atom (Se) is at the center and it is surrounded by 3 Oxygen atoms (O). The Selenium atom does not have a lone pair while all the three Oxygen atoms have 2 lone pairs.

Why is SO2 bent and CO2 linear?

Carbon dioxide is linear, while sulphur dioxide is bent (V-shaped). In the carbon dioxide, the two double bonds try to get as far apart as possible, and so the molecule is linear. In sulphur dioxide, as well as the two double bonds, there is also a lone pair on the sulphur.
